4. Youth Programs Create Long-Term Value for Parents
Parents often evaluate memberships based on how much value they provide for their children.
At the IC, youth programming is a major part of the membership experience.
Programs include:
- Swim lessons
- ORCA Swim Team
- Basketball
- Soccer
- Tennis
- Pickleball
- Volleyball
- Robotics and coding
- Art programs
- Summer camp
- After-school activities
These programs allow children to stay active, build confidence, and develop social skills in a supportive environment.
Instead of constantly searching for new programs around town, families can access many opportunities through one membership.
For parents, this creates convenience. For children, it creates consistency and opportunities for growth.
As children move through different stages of development, the IC provides programs that evolve alongside their interests and abilities.
